With “Sagherat Assani,” the Grammy-award-winning inventors of the desert blues announce the upcoming release of their tenth studio album, Hoggar. Teaming up with Sudanese singer Sulafa Elyas, Tinariwen perform this traditional song that Abdallah Ag Alhousseyni and his band member Japonais (who passed away in 2021) first encountered in the Libyan-Sudanese border town Al Kufrah in 1989. “We loved it so much that Japonais learned it, then played it again and again, allowing it to travel and endure,” says Alhousseyni.
Tinariwen - Sagherat Assani (Algeria/Sudan)

The Rio-based project Pra Gira Girar have released a new version of the song “Atabaque Chora“, originally by the trio Os Tincoãs. Written by Dadinho and Mateus Aleluia, the song opened the group’s legendary self-titled 1977 album. The single very much follows in the steps of Os Tincoãs with its close harmonic spaces and Afro-Brazilian chants that made their music so innovative and special. "Deixa a Gira Girar" is the second single released by the group Pra Gira Girar in homage to the Bahian trio Os Tincoãs.
Pra Gira Girar - Deixa a Gira Girar (Brazil)

Parlor Greens is an American soul-jazz band formed in Loveland, Ohio. Parlor Greens' take on Dolly Parton's classic Jolene with their trademark funky organ sound! Gritty Hammond organ takes the melody while Jimmy James' signature rhythm guitar drives the whole thing! Tim Carman holds it down on the kit nice and tight keeping everything right in the pocket in a way that would make Dolly proud!
Parlor Greens - Jolene (USA)
